0
私はTabNavigatorの背景をグラデーションにしようとしています。 https://facebook.github.io/react-native/docs/colors.htmlのドキュメントでは、のカラープロパティは通常、CSSがウェブ上でどのように動作するかを示しています。私はhttps://developer.mozilla.org/en-US/docs/Web/CSS/linear-gradientに行き、を読んでいます。sはデータ型に属しているので、sを使うことができるところでしか使用できません。このため、背景色やデータ型を使用するその他のプロパティではlinear-gradient()は機能しません。TabBarのグラデーションの背景?
その結果、以下のうではない作品:
import { TabNavigator, TabBarBottom } from 'react-navigation';
export default TabNavigator(
{
Home: {
screen: HomeScreen,
},
. . .
},
{
navigationOptions: ({ navigation }) => ({
tabBarIcon: ....
tabBarComponent: TabBarBottom,
tabBarPosition: 'bottom',
animationEnabled: false,
swipeEnabled: false,
tabBarOptions: {
activeTintColor: 'rgb(111, 111, 111)',
labelStyle: {
fontSize: 12,
},
style: {
backgroundColor: 'linear-gradient(45deg, blue, red)',
},
}
}
);
文書から明らかです。何がはっきりしていない何がうまくいくのですか?